Wes Taylor is here. Taylor lives in Broadlands and is here to discuss a potential development.

They want to build a top of the line self storage complex by the Monicals. He is here to feel out the board since he would need a special use permit. Max Painter said he would like to see something else there. Terri Cummings saying the board needs to think about what the community needs there and told Taylor he could come build houses here when the community expands.

Taylor saying Monicals has to agree with whatever is built there. Taylor is giving them more information on his project.

Painter saying that it scares him to say no to Taylor then nothing else goes there.

Nothing decided.

Clark Dietz is here to discuss the northern utility expansion. This is very complex so I will get a copy of it and report back.

Discussing the public works storage needs. Vehicles, equipment would go in it. EZ Loc storage in Urbana has a unit that would work for $310 per month. That is not ideal, according to the administrator.

Discussing sports complex field maintenance agreement. Dan Davis saying they need to improve the facilities to attract tournaments and bring in more sales tax revenue to area businesses.

they are currently discussing the schedule for vehicle replacement.

Buying a flock camera that they already budgeted.

April 5 the high school is using the sports complex for a mock accident. #ILOVETHESE #suchagoodlesson

WCIA Our Town wants to come out on June 9. Tami said the village is interested.

A new deputy is in town. Tami is praising the police for their response to the incidents on Wednesday.
